Choosing the Right Pool Heater


The journey to a warmer pool begins with selecting the appropriate pool heater. The market offers a variety of options, including gas heaters, electric heat pumps, and solar heaters, each with its unique set of benefits and considerations.


Gas heaters, powered by natural gas or propane, are known for their efficiency in quickly heating pools, making them ideal for pool owners looking to heat their pools swiftly. Electric heat pumps, on the other hand, are lauded for their energy efficiency, using outside air to heat the pool and thus, are more cost-effective over time. Solar heaters, the most eco-friendly option, utilize solar panels to capture and transfer heat to the pool water. While the initial setup cost might be higher and efficiency is weather-dependent, solar heaters have minimal operational costs.


The Installation Process


The installation of a pool heater is a process that requires precision, expertise, and an understanding of both the pool's dynamics and the selected heating system. The initial step involves a thorough assessment of the pool’s size, type, and location, as well as the climate of the area. This assessment is crucial in determining the most suitable heater type and size for your pool.


Following the selection of the heater, the installation process begins. For gas heaters, this involves connecting the heater to a gas line, while electric heat pumps require electrical connections. Solar heaters necessitate the placement and installation of solar panels in a location with optimal sunlight exposure.
